What is the main component of rocks on earth's surface?

The main component of rocks on Earth's surface is minerals. Rocks are made up of one or more minerals, which are naturally occurring inorganic substances with a specific chemical composition and crystal structure. Minerals such as quartz, feldspar, and mica are common components of rocks found on the Earth's surface.
